The TP-Link ER7206 SafeStream is a purpose-built Gigabit Multi-WAN VPN Router, featuring 5 Gigabit Ethernet ports (including 1 SFP WAN port) and a USB 3.2 Gen 1 port for versatile connectivity options. This router is designed to deliver high-performance routing and advanced security features for small to mid-sized business networks.
As a core component of the Omada Software Defined Networking (SDN) solution, the ER7206 enables centralized cloud management, allowing IT teams to deploy, monitor, and manage their entire network infrastructure, including access points and switches, from a single dashboard.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can the TP-Link ER7206 manage other network devices like switches or access points?
Yes, the ER7206 integrates with the Omada Software Defined Networking (SDN) platform, allowing centralized management of Omada-compatible access points and switches from a single cloud interface.
How does the multi-WAN feature improve internet reliability for my business?
The multi-WAN feature allows you to connect to multiple internet service providers simultaneously. The router can then load balance traffic across these connections for better performance or automatically switch to a backup connection if the primary one fails, ensuring continuous internet access.
What types of VPNs does the ER7206 support for secure remote access?
The ER7206 supports various VPN protocols, including SSL VPN, Wireguard VPN, IPSec VPN, and OpenVPN, enabling secure and encrypted connections for remote employees or site-to-site links.
